Sometimes you just need to make a mess to make a breakthrough, it’s the process. The breakthrough in artmaking comes for me when I can settle into recognizing the piece that I am working on is internally satisfying and that I can see its beauty. Contemporary artwork may be particularly challenging in this respect. Often times the satisfaction comes slowly and a piece will go through many states of exploration (a word that I use a lot) until I risk considering it completed.

Then there are other times when paint, plaster, pencil or other materials flow on the canvas or board and I am delighted with what has happened in a very little amount of time.

The question is then, “where did that come from?” Has the mess transformed into a vision that touches me and that I am ready to share with the world? The phrase “Beauty is in the eye of the beholder” applies here and today all I see is beauty in the process!
